Health

India ranked a low 120th in a survey of 123 nations on safe water index

USD 1.5 billion spent on rural medical expenses annually

1600 children die in India every day due to waterborne disease

Stunted development of 20 million children annually

Two-thirds of hospital beds in India filled with patients with waterborne disease

USD 600 million- Economic cost of waterborne diseases annually

73 million working days lost due to waterborne diseases

Rain Water Harvesting – Advantages

• Sustain or maintain the ground water table.

• Enhancing the ground water resource capacity.

• Improving the ground water quality by diluting the harmful chemicals such as As, Fe, Pb, Hg, Cd, Fl, NO3, etc.

• Reducing the cost of drilling bore wells as after aquifer recharging the table is to increase and the drilling depth shall drastically reduce.

• Easy availability of fresh water at the shallow levels under ground.

Precipitation & AbsorptionPrecipitation & AbsorptionFor Iron, Arsenic, and other Heavy MetalsFor Iron, Arsenic, and other Heavy Metals

• Ferric Hydroxide or Hydrated Ferric Oxide is widely accepted media for the removal of naturally occurring heavy metals from water.

• The process offered is capable of generating Ferric Hydroxide or Hydrated Ferric Oxide on its own and shall keep on enhancing the Heavy Metal Removal efficiency.

• Oxidation chamber oxidise the dissolved iron and produce Ferric Hydroxide.

• This produced Ferric Hydroxide shall be in precipitate form.

• This precipitate of Ferric Hydroxide laden water stream is passed through a Sand Bed Filter.

• At Sand Bed Filter this precipitate is trapped in various layers of it which actually form a very thin coat on the fine sand granules.

• This thin coat of Ferric Hydroxide on the fine sand granules maximises the surface area of the created Ferric Hydroxide coated Sand Bed which enhances the Heavy Metals removal efficiency.

• Activated Alumina media adsorbent has fluoride uptake capacity more than 5000 mg/kg as compared to 2300 mg/kg specified by Public Health Engineering Department of various State Governments and 1800` mg/kg as specified by UNICEF.

• The water properties has been maintained as per WHO Standard.

• The appropriate particle size is 0.40 – 1.2 mm in spherical or granular form for the maximised contact area.

• This product has a Bed Crushing Strength of > 99%, Surface Area is >370 m²/gm and Bulk Density 0.68 – 0.75 gm/cc.

• The other specifications are same as released by U.N.I.C.E.F. for Fluoride Removal application, and the same media is widely used by U.N.I.C.E.F. in India for De – fluoridation.

Technology – Adsorption Technology – Adsorption (Activated Alumina)(Activated Alumina)

System MaintenanceSystem MaintenanceFRU / NRU / ARUFRU / NRU / ARU

• The systems are required to be backwashed every fortnight. One individual from the location is recruited and trained for doing so at regular interval.

• The media quantity per treatment scheme is designed in such a manner that the regeneration is required after 6 to 18 months:• De – fluoridation Six to Nine months• Nitrate Removal Six to Nine months • Iron Removal Eighteen to Thirty Six months • Heavy Metals Removal Eighteen to Thirty Six months

• Specialized trained personals are deputed for carrying these periodically.

• Every regeneration is followed by the water testing of that location.

• The media is proposed to be replaced after every 4 regenerations. Hence there is no possibility of any slippage / leaching and channeling in the media bed.

Bio Mass MediaBio Mass Media

• Specialty Natural Shell media is used for Fluoride Removal.

• Bone Ash or Bone Charcoal may also be used in place of Specialty Natural Shell media.

• It has high and steady absorption capacity for Fluoride.

• The regeneration of Bio Mass media is done by Auto claveing at 200 Deg. C.

• Regular backwash with Alum for maintaining the contact surface clean and exposed to Fluoride containing water.
